CVS Health Corp. had the following transactions during January, the first month of its operations:
Issued 24,000 shares of common stock in exchange for $240,000.
Purchased equipment for $480,000, using a $120,000 cash down payment and signing a note payable for the balance.
Received $3,000 from a customer for services to be performed in February
Made a $36,000 payment on the note payable from the purchase of the equipment.
Total monthly sales: Cash sales $90,000 & Credit Sales $43,000.
Purchased supplies on credit for $38,400.
Collected $14,000 from customers on account.
Paid $3,000 for January employee wages.
Received a utility bill for $1,100 which will be paid next month.
What is the balance in the Cash account that the end of January?
Select one:
a. $174,000
b. $171,000
c.-$52,000
d. $188,000
e. $240,000
